How they compare

Tanzania, United Republic of currently reports 141.75 billion constant LCU against 78.99 billion constant LCU in Rwanda, a difference of 62.75 billion constant LCU.

That makes Tanzania, United Republic of's figure about 1.8 times Rwanda's.

Across all 13 years both countries report, Tanzania, United Republic of has been ahead every year.

Rwanda ranks 6th and Tanzania, United Republic of ranks 3rd of 31 countries.

Tanzania, United Republic of has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Value added in banking is defined as the value of output of the banking industry less the value of intermediate consumption (intermediate inputs). Banking is a subset of services, comprising financial intermediation (ISIC 65-67). Data are in constant local currency.
